Manager, Transfusion Services - (260504-50025053)
Purpose of Position: To direct, coordinate, market, and oversee all aspects of Blood Transfusion Services, Donor collection programs throughout Cape Cod Hospital Laboratory and Cape Cod Healthcare facilities.

Assures the development, coordination, implementation and standardization of all policies, procedures, and practices of all Blood Bank operations at Cape Cod Healthcare's laboratories. Provides services to meet all Cape Cod Healthcare patient needs in accordance with accepted standards and practices.
Oversees all related operations of the Blood Donor Center/Program. Continually seeks means of marketing and expanding services. Continuously increases collections by growing internal database as well as external drives or mobile collections. Explores means of decreasing dependency on purchased blood from outside sources thereby decreasing costs
Supervises the performance of procedures to obtain and provide data and blood products for use in patient diagnosis and treatment including but not limited to:
Orients new hires and oversees training of all staff and evaluates work performance, according to the guidelines established for the department to determine employee competence
Serves as a technical reference in for blood bank, donor room and hospital staff
Recommends, develops, and maintains Quality Control, Quality Assurance, and Quality Improvement programs
Maintains thorough understanding of CAP, AABB and FDA standards to ensure operational compliance with all regulatory agencies
